Vanua Balavu is one of the Lau Islands in eastern Fiji, a secluded gem where traditional Fijian culture and natural beauty flourish in harmony. Surrounded by turquoise waters and coral reefs, the island offers a serene escape from bustling tourist areas, with small villages, coconut groves, and rugged hills shaping its peaceful landscape. Life here moves at a relaxed pace, and visitors are welcomed into a community that retains its ancestral customs and close connection to the sea.

The island’s natural features are remarkable. Pristine beaches and clear lagoons provide excellent snorkeling and diving opportunities, while the surrounding reefs support vibrant marine life. Inland, walking trails reveal lush tropical forests and panoramic views of neighboring islands. Vanua Balavu’s reefs and coastal areas are also part of Fiji’s efforts to preserve marine biodiversity, ensuring the environment remains healthy for future generations.

Vanua Balavu exudes a sense of authenticity and tranquility. Traditional Fijian ceremonies, local crafts, and the simplicity of village life offer visitors a window into a culture deeply tied to its land and waters.

Nadi, a vibrant city on Fiji's western coast, offers a gateway to some of the South Pacific's most enchanting experiences. Known for its bustling markets and lively atmosphere, Nadi is a hub of culture and activity. A must-see is the Sri Siva Subramaniya Temple, the largest Hindu temple in the Southern Hemisphere, renowned for its intricate Dravidian architecture and colorful frescoes. The temple’s vibrant and spiritual ambiance provides a glimpse into Fiji's rich Indian heritage.

The Coral Coast stretches along the southern edge of Fiji’s main island of Viti Levu, beginning around 15 km south of Nadi and continuing toward Suva. This 80 km shoreline is dotted with beaches that widen at low tide, bays set against green hills, and a series of small townships that feel welcoming and down to earth. Sigatoka, often called the gateway to the Coral Coast, sits beside the winding Sigatoka River, where local markets brim with fresh tropical fruit and handmade crafts.
